How to Fill Out a Form in Juvenile Court:
01
Start by carefully reading the instructions: Before filling out any form, it is important to read the instructions provided. These instructions will guide you through the form-filling process and ensure that you provide accurate and complete information.
02
Gather all necessary information: Before sitting down to fill out the form, gather all the necessary information that you will need to include. This may include personal details of the juvenile involved, their legal guardian's information, court case details, and any other relevant information.
03
Use legible handwriting: When filling out the form, use legible handwriting to ensure that the information you provide can be easily read and understood by court officials. If possible, consider using a typewriter or filling out the form online if that option is available.
04
Provide accurate and honest information: It is crucial to provide accurate and honest information on the form. The information you provide will be used in legal proceedings, so any false or misleading information can have serious consequences.
05
Follow any formatting rules: Some forms may have specific formatting rules that need to be followed. Pay attention to any guidelines regarding spacing, capitalization, or format requirements and follow them accordingly.
06
Ask for assistance if needed: If you are unsure about how to fill out any section of the form, do not hesitate to seek assistance. You can contact the court clerk or seek guidance from an attorney who specializes in juvenile law to ensure that you complete the form accurately.
Who Needs a Form in Juvenile Court?
01
Juveniles involved in legal proceedings: The primary individuals who need to fill out a form in juvenile court are the juveniles themselves who are involved in legal proceedings. These may include situations such as delinquency hearings or dependency cases.
02
Legal guardians of juveniles: In many cases, the legal guardian or parent of the juvenile may also need to fill out forms in juvenile court. This is necessary to provide essential information about the juvenile and their circumstances.
03
Attorneys and legal representatives: Attorneys or legal representatives who are representing the juveniles in court may also need to fill out forms related to the legal proceedings. They will often complete forms that include details about their clients' cases or file different motions or petitions on behalf of the juveniles.
04
Court officials and clerks: Court officials and clerks also play a role in completing forms in juvenile court. They ensure that all the necessary forms are filled out correctly and filed appropriately, maintaining a record of the legal proceedings.
In summary, filling out a form in juvenile court requires careful reading of instructions, gathering necessary information, legible handwriting, providing accurate details, following formatting rules, and seeking assistance if needed. Various individuals like juveniles, legal guardians, attorneys, and court officials may need to fill out these forms depending on their roles in the legal proceedings.
